For the 2026 school year, there are 16 public schools serving 18,378 students in 92223, CA (there are 2 private schools, serving 191 private students). 99% of all K-12 students in 92223, CA are educated in public schools (compared to the CA state average of 90%).
The top-ranked public schools in 92223, CA are Sundance Elementary School, Brookside Elementary School and Tournament Hills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 92223 have an average math proficiency score of 30% (versus the California public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 45% (versus the 47% statewide average). Schools in 92223, CA have an average ranking of 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of California public schools.
Minority enrollment is 72%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the California public school average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
